   I know this is offtopic, but the spam problem is getting worse,
   could the linux-kernel mail guy/gal, do something, the nigerian
   scams are actually dangerous.

They never make it to the lists, if they are sending these
spams to you privately that is your problem to resolve :-)

Look we simply cannot control what web site archives of these
lists choose to do with the sender's email address.  If you
post here, you will almost certainly get on a spam list.
There is zero we as postmasters can do about this.
